summarylogtreecommitdiffstats
diff options
context:
space:
mode:
authorpingplug2019-03-02 20:29:01 +0800
committerpingplug2019-03-02 20:29:01 +0800
commit00915a6940988d240aaf78d0f2903a807990c91d (patch)
tree20806a61d5223f2fc2accea0422da31ca32face6
parentd1391c73dfc4dfb80237382abd16c4624b170f80 (diff)
downloadaur-00915a6940988d240aaf78d0f2903a807990c91d.tar.gz
Updated to 2.45.5
-rw-r--r--.SRCINFO8
-rw-r--r--PKGBUILD6
-rw-r--r--makefile-fix.patch48
3 files changed, 30 insertions, 32 deletions
diff --git a/.SRCINFO b/.SRCINFO
index 27a175f25a34..23acfa5e871e 100644
--- a/.SRCINFO
+++ b/.SRCINFO
@@ -1,6 +1,6 @@
pkgbase = mingw-w64-librsvg
pkgdesc = A SVG viewing library (mingw-w64)
- pkgver = 2.45.4
+ pkgver = 2.45.5
pkgrel = 1
url = https://wiki.gnome.org/action/show/Projects/LibRsvg
arch = any
@@ -19,10 +19,10 @@ pkgbase = mingw-w64-librsvg
options = !strip
options = staticlibs
options = !buildflags
- source = https://download.gnome.org/sources/librsvg/2.45/librsvg-2.45.4.tar.xz
+ source = https://download.gnome.org/sources/librsvg/2.45/librsvg-2.45.5.tar.xz
source = makefile-fix.patch
- sha256sums = eeb6105cb28deec7a8a2ef270ae86b13fc555ff7dc85014a6b3e7cf0e88a7b4f
- sha256sums = bec98d5cb0a74e22c2351915e6be101361a4af7d8fcac674d07d1f0c7de9b1f7
+ sha256sums = 600872dc608fe5e01bfd8d5b3046d01b53b99121bc5ab9663531b53630843700
+ sha256sums = f205ca4cfafbd5014585767587435400935bba532a266566dd93a75db4e7ccf9
pkgname = mingw-w64-librsvg
diff --git a/PKGBUILD b/PKGBUILD
index b7df7c43acfa..a520b90b3669 100644
--- a/PKGBUILD
+++ b/PKGBUILD
@@ -4,7 +4,7 @@
_architectures="i686-w64-mingw32 x86_64-w64-mingw32"
pkgname=mingw-w64-librsvg
-pkgver=2.45.4
+pkgver=2.45.5
pkgrel=1
pkgdesc="A SVG viewing library (mingw-w64)"
arch=('any')
@@ -24,8 +24,8 @@ makedepends=('mingw-w64-configure'
options=('!strip' 'staticlibs' '!buildflags')
source=("https://download.gnome.org/sources/librsvg/${pkgver%.*}/librsvg-${pkgver}.tar.xz"
"makefile-fix.patch")
-sha256sums=('eeb6105cb28deec7a8a2ef270ae86b13fc555ff7dc85014a6b3e7cf0e88a7b4f'
- 'bec98d5cb0a74e22c2351915e6be101361a4af7d8fcac674d07d1f0c7de9b1f7')
+sha256sums=('600872dc608fe5e01bfd8d5b3046d01b53b99121bc5ab9663531b53630843700'
+ 'f205ca4cfafbd5014585767587435400935bba532a266566dd93a75db4e7ccf9')
prepare() {
cd "${srcdir}/librsvg-${pkgver}"
diff --git a/makefile-fix.patch b/makefile-fix.patch
index 9bc65aed6655..e7d863c163cf 100644
--- a/makefile-fix.patch
+++ b/makefile-fix.patch
@@ -1,7 +1,7 @@
-diff -ruN librsvg-2.44.8/Makefile.am librsvg-2.44.8-patched/Makefile.am
---- librsvg-2.44.8/Makefile.am 2018-08-31 02:39:42.000000000 +0800
-+++ librsvg-2.44.8-patched/Makefile.am 2018-08-31 14:57:47.170559312 +0800
-@@ -143,6 +143,7 @@
+diff -ruN librsvg-2.45.5/Makefile.am librsvg-2.45.5-fixed/Makefile.am
+--- librsvg-2.45.5/Makefile.am 2019-02-16 01:01:25.000000000 +0800
++++ librsvg-2.45.5-fixed/Makefile.am 2019-03-02 20:17:17.432974000 +0800
+@@ -139,6 +139,7 @@
cargo_verbose_1 = --verbose
RUST_LIB=@abs_top_builddir@/target/@RUST_TARGET_SUBDIR@/librsvg_internals.a
@@ -9,17 +9,16 @@ diff -ruN librsvg-2.44.8/Makefile.am librsvg-2.44.8-patched/Makefile.am
CARGO_TARGET_DIR=@abs_top_builddir@/target
check-local:
-@@ -171,7 +172,8 @@
+@@ -167,7 +168,7 @@
PKG_CONFIG_ALLOW_CROSS=1 \
PKG_CONFIG='$(PKG_CONFIG)' \
CARGO_TARGET_DIR=$(CARGO_TARGET_DIR) \
-- cargo build $(CARGO_VERBOSE) $(CARGO_TARGET_ARGS) $(CARGO_RELEASE_ARGS)
-+ cargo build $(CARGO_VERBOSE) $(CARGO_TARGET_ARGS) $(CARGO_RELEASE_ARGS) \
-+ && cp $(RUST_LIB_WIN) $(RUST_LIB)
+- $(CARGO) build $(CARGO_VERBOSE) $(CARGO_TARGET_ARGS) $(CARGO_RELEASE_ARGS)
++ $(CARGO) build $(CARGO_VERBOSE) $(CARGO_TARGET_ARGS) $(CARGO_RELEASE_ARGS) && cp $(RUST_LIB_WIN) $(RUST_LIB)
librsvg_@RSVG_API_MAJOR_VERSION@_la_CPPFLAGS = \
-I$(top_srcdir) \
-@@ -197,7 +199,6 @@
+@@ -193,7 +194,6 @@
$(AM_LDFLAGS)
librsvg_@RSVG_API_MAJOR_VERSION@_la_LIBADD = \
@@ -27,10 +26,10 @@ diff -ruN librsvg-2.44.8/Makefile.am librsvg-2.44.8-patched/Makefile.am
$(LIBRSVG_LIBS) \
$(LIBM) \
$(DLOPEN_LIBS)
-diff -ruN librsvg-2.44.8/Makefile.in librsvg-2.44.8-patched/Makefile.in
---- librsvg-2.44.8/Makefile.in 2018-08-31 02:39:57.000000000 +0800
-+++ librsvg-2.44.8-patched/Makefile.in 2018-08-31 14:57:47.170559312 +0800
-@@ -224,7 +224,7 @@
+diff -ruN librsvg-2.45.5/Makefile.in librsvg-2.45.5-fixed/Makefile.in
+--- librsvg-2.45.5/Makefile.in 2019-02-16 07:42:52.000000000 +0800
++++ librsvg-2.45.5-fixed/Makefile.in 2019-03-02 20:17:17.432974000 +0800
+@@ -227,7 +227,7 @@
}
LTLIBRARIES = $(lib_LTLIBRARIES)
am__DEPENDENCIES_1 =
@@ -39,7 +38,7 @@ diff -ruN librsvg-2.44.8/Makefile.in librsvg-2.44.8-patched/Makefile.in
$(am__DEPENDENCIES_1) $(am__DEPENDENCIES_1) \
$(am__DEPENDENCIES_1)
am__dirstamp = $(am__leading_dot)dirstamp
-@@ -733,6 +733,7 @@
+@@ -739,6 +739,7 @@
cargo_verbose_0 =
cargo_verbose_1 = --verbose
RUST_LIB = @abs_top_builddir@/target/@RUST_TARGET_SUBDIR@/librsvg_internals.a
@@ -47,7 +46,7 @@ diff -ruN librsvg-2.44.8/Makefile.in librsvg-2.44.8-patched/Makefile.in
CARGO_TARGET_DIR = @abs_top_builddir@/target
librsvg_@RSVG_API_MAJOR_VERSION@_la_CPPFLAGS = \
-I$(top_srcdir) \
-@@ -758,7 +759,6 @@
+@@ -764,7 +765,6 @@
$(AM_LDFLAGS)
librsvg_@RSVG_API_MAJOR_VERSION@_la_LIBADD = \
@@ -55,24 +54,23 @@ diff -ruN librsvg-2.44.8/Makefile.in librsvg-2.44.8-patched/Makefile.in
$(LIBRSVG_LIBS) \
$(LIBM) \
$(DLOPEN_LIBS)
-@@ -1110,8 +1110,8 @@
- librsvg/@RSVG_API_MAJOR_VERSION@_la-rsvg-styles.lo: \
+@@ -1103,8 +1103,8 @@
+ librsvg/@RSVG_API_MAJOR_VERSION@_la-rsvg-pixbuf.lo: \
librsvg/$(am__dirstamp) librsvg/$(DEPDIR)/$(am__dirstamp)
-librsvg-@RSVG_API_MAJOR_VERSION@.la: $(librsvg_@RSVG_API_MAJOR_VERSION@_la_OBJECTS) $(librsvg_@RSVG_API_MAJOR_VERSION@_la_DEPENDENCIES) $(EXTRA_librsvg_@RSVG_API_MAJOR_VERSION@_la_DEPENDENCIES)
- $(AM_V_CCLD)$(librsvg_@RSVG_API_MAJOR_VERSION@_la_LINK) -rpath $(libdir) $(librsvg_@RSVG_API_MAJOR_VERSION@_la_OBJECTS) $(librsvg_@RSVG_API_MAJOR_VERSION@_la_LIBADD) $(LIBS)
+librsvg-@RSVG_API_MAJOR_VERSION@.la: $(librsvg_@RSVG_API_MAJOR_VERSION@_la_OBJECTS) $(RUST_LIB) $(librsvg_@RSVG_API_MAJOR_VERSION@_la_DEPENDENCIES) $(EXTRA_librsvg_@RSVG_API_MAJOR_VERSION@_la_DEPENDENCIES)
+ $(AM_V_CCLD)$(librsvg_@RSVG_API_MAJOR_VERSION@_la_LINK) -rpath $(libdir) $(librsvg_@RSVG_API_MAJOR_VERSION@_la_OBJECTS) $(RUST_LIB) $(librsvg_@RSVG_API_MAJOR_VERSION@_la_LIBADD) $(LIBS)
- librsvg/rsvg_convert-rsvg-size-callback.$(OBJEXT): \
- librsvg/$(am__dirstamp) librsvg/$(DEPDIR)/$(am__dirstamp)
-@@ -1969,7 +1969,8 @@
+ rsvg-convert$(EXEEXT): $(rsvg_convert_OBJECTS) $(rsvg_convert_DEPENDENCIES) $(EXTRA_rsvg_convert_DEPENDENCIES)
+ @rm -f rsvg-convert$(EXEEXT)
+@@ -1893,7 +1893,7 @@
PKG_CONFIG_ALLOW_CROSS=1 \
PKG_CONFIG='$(PKG_CONFIG)' \
CARGO_TARGET_DIR=$(CARGO_TARGET_DIR) \
-- cargo build $(CARGO_VERBOSE) $(CARGO_TARGET_ARGS) $(CARGO_RELEASE_ARGS)
-+ cargo build $(CARGO_VERBOSE) $(CARGO_TARGET_ARGS) $(CARGO_RELEASE_ARGS) \
-+ && cp $(RUST_LIB_WIN) $(RUST_LIB)
+- $(CARGO) build $(CARGO_VERBOSE) $(CARGO_TARGET_ARGS) $(CARGO_RELEASE_ARGS)
++ $(CARGO) build $(CARGO_VERBOSE) $(CARGO_TARGET_ARGS) $(CARGO_RELEASE_ARGS) && cp $(RUST_LIB_WIN) $(RUST_LIB)
+
+ @HAVE_INTROSPECTION_TRUE@-include $(INTROSPECTION_MAKEFILE)
- librsvg/librsvg-enum-types.h: librsvg/s-enum-types-h
- @true